> On May 25, 2014, 10:30 a.m., Michal Humpula wrote:
> > Albert, please try to open session with several hundred documents with and \
> > without your patch. I think this was done, because adding nodes to models was \
> > generating all sorts of events and it slowed down the load time, even though the \
> > only events that matters are the last ones.
>
> Albert Astals Cid wrote:
> Well, the ui is broken, is that acceptable for a ¿corner case? speed win?
>
> Michal Humpula wrote:
> For one person "corner case" is for another "common thing". But I get your point.
>
> Isn't there another way to tell the views: "stop redrawing until I finish this big \
> transaction"? The spead up is not small, it goes like ten times, if I remember \
> correctly.
There's this: http://qt-project.org/doc/qt-4.8/qwidget.html#updatesEnabled-prop
- Sven
